2. Press the SPACE bar to choose either ENABLED or DISABLED. ENABLED allows the COM port to be connected to the terminal and used for a particular application. DISABLED disallows the COM port connection to the terminal.
!
CAUTION
Do NOT disable or alter the settings of the COM port while
operating the current Local Management connection through a
terminal. Altering the COM port settings disconnects the Local
Management terminal from the port, and ends the Local
Management session. If the 2H22-08R was previously
assigned a valid IP address, reenter Local Management by
establishing a Telnet connection to the device. If the device
does not have a valid IP address and the COM port has been
disabled or the settings changed, reset NVRAM on the
2H22-08R (refer to Section 5.7.11) to reestablish COM port
communications.
